Yes, I like plants. I like them a lot. And I like them even more when they have a fantastical side to it, which is what I'm looking for right now.
Fantastical trees, bizarre fruits, sentient flowers--you know the drill. They can be part of the main setting or play an important part in the plot. A note please, I've read a lot of stories where only one tree was special and because it had a spirit or a god in them and I am not looking for these kind of stories. I might accept a plant-person if there is more to the story that involves plants than just this human-like plant.
I would love it even more if you recommend me a story with a character in it who has a certain afinity with them. As in, the plants seem to favor them? Or someone like Kurama (his power), from YuYu Hakusho being the main character.
So far, I've only encountered a manga, Silver diamond, and a webcomic, Kisswood, that fit. Do you happen to know more stories like these?
As long as this condition(s) are met, I couldn't careless about demographics or romance or sexualities or whatever else.
Thank you in advance.
Ps: I checked the Plants category and searched the forums. I only found Yasei no Bara to be attractive.
I'm too greedy to be satisfied with only one title.

Nausicaa of the Valley of the Wind
There's a toxic jungle and the humans want to condemn it. Nausicaa thinks they can coexist. It's a manga and a movie.
Edit: She definitely has an affinity for the plants.
